
From another thriller for Formula 1 at Silverstone to veteran dominance in the NHRA’s return to Indianapolis, the latest Motorsports Drop is jam packed with results from the past weekend. We’ve also got all the big winners from NASCAR’s premier series at Michigan and Road America, plus the return of Stadium Super Trucks.